    ### Test using MinIO Client `mc`
    
    `mc` provides a modern alternative to UNIX commands like ls, cat, cp, mirror, diff etc. It supports filesystems and Amazon S3 compatible cloud storage services.
    
    The following commands set a local alias, validate the server information, create a bucket, copy data to that bucket, and list the contents of the bucket.

  5. apache-maven/src/assembly/maven/conf/settings.xml

         |
         | An encouraged best practice for profile identification is to use a consistent naming convention
         | for profiles, such as 'env-dev', 'env-test', 'env-production', 'user-jdcasey', 'user-brett', etc.
         | This will make it more intuitive to understand what the set of introduced profiles is attempting
         | to accomplish, particularly when you only have a list of profile id's for debug.
